For decades, Hollywood and global entertainment industries operated under a glaring double standard: male actors gained distinction and “gravitas” as they aged, while their female counterparts faced dwindling roles, typecasting, and cultural invisibility. The success of these projects comes down to a simple economic reality: the audience is aging. According to the MPAA, the average moviegoer in the US is now 39 years old, and the fastest-growing segment of cinema-goers is the 60+ demographic.
